OneDrive Sync
This feature allows you to display files stored in Microsoft OneDrive on your Smartsign screens.
This makes it easy to show presentations, images, videos, and other shared files directly in Smartsign and keep them updated from OneDrive.
How it works
When you add a file from OneDrive, Smartsign creates a synchronized media item in the Media Library that is linked to the original file in your OneDrive account.
Smartsign periodically checks the source file in OneDrive for updates. If the file has changed, the updated version is automatically synchronized to Smartsign and distributed to the screens where the media is scheduled.
This allows you to update content directly in OneDrive without needing to upload the file again in Smartsign.
The maximum update frequency is once per hour. Changes made in OneDrive may take up to one hour before they are reflected on your screens.
Requirements
To use the feature, you need:
- A Microsoft account with access to OneDrive.
- Permission to access the files or folders that will be synchronized.
- Administrator approval for the Smartsign OneDrive Sync application.
Add OneDrive media to Media Library
Follow these steps to add and sync a file from OneDrive to your Media Library:
- Go to media library and create a folder for the synced files.

- Open folder and select Add Media.

- Click Upload File.

- Select OneDrive.

- Authenticate with your Microsoft account.

- The first time you authenticate, you may need to allow pop-ups in
your web browser.

To allow pop-ups in most browsers, click the lock or alert icon on the right side of the address bar and select Always allow, or open Site Settings to manage pop-up permissions.
- After authentication, browse and select one or more files you want to use from
OneDrive.

- Select synchronize to sync the files with Smartsign.

- Once the sync is complete, you can book the content on your screens.
Changes made to the file in OneDrive will automatically be reflected
on your screens after the next synchronization.

- The file details show which sync source is used.

Permissions required
Smartsign OneDrive Sync, Application (client) ID : f1f9ae1e-fc86-4af3-89fc-95d63c8b4a13
| Permission | Type | Microsoft description | Used for |
|---|---|---|---|
| Files.Read.All | Delegated | Read all files that user can access | Allows the app to read all files you can access |
| offline_access | Delegated | Maintain access to data you have given it access to | Allows the app to see and update the data you gave it access |
| Sites.Read.All | Delegated | Read items in all site collections | Allows the app to read files and list items in site collections on your behalf |
| User.Read | Delegated | Sign in and read user profile | Sign-in to the app, allows the app to read the profile of the signed-in user |